Figure shows two basic types of jaw crushers single toggle and double toggle In the single toggle jaw crusher an eccentric shaft is installed on the top of the crusher Shaft rotation causes along with the toggle plate a compressive action of the moving jaw A double toggle crusher has basically two shafts and two toggle plates
